SAN SEBASTIÁN, SPAIN
San Sebastián is a beautiful city with a European feel and a courteous highly-cultured population who speak correct, very clear Spanish. It is much more than a beautiful city with beaches. As the cultural capital of the Basque country it has many events and festivals all year round. It is a very pleasant middle size city (population 180,000) on the northern Spanish "Green Coast", only 20 kilometers from France. It has three beaches, a lively old part, a historical center with pedestrianized streets and neo-classical architecture.
As a center for Spanish culture, the city hosts concerts, festivals and events year round including the International Film Festival, Jazz Festival, classical music and fireworks festivals. Add to this the Basque traditions, sports and fairs, the delicious world-class food, and the friendliness of the people, and you will understand how people easily fall in love with San Sebastián.
The average temperatures in the summer of 72 Fahrenheit, and winter 46 F. There is a second official language in this Basque area, but you will find it will never interfere with your learning of standard Spanish.
CULTURAL ACTIVITIES
San Sebastián offers endless possibilities to enjoy your free time - lively night life, the Old Part, romantic walks along the beach, the Castle of the Wind Comb, excursions, museums, exhibitions, 40 cinemas, theaters, cultural centers, the Convention Center.
The school organizes intercambio parties, talks and lectures, videos, and international meals. In San Sebastián you can play all kinds of sports such as golf, tennis, and horseback riding. Many surfers are attracted to the waves in Gros, Mundaka and Hossegor.
The Mundaiz Gymnasium, next to the school, offers Lacunza students preferential rates. The Municipal Sports Council is very active, and if you become a member you can get into the sports centers and take part in the courses that it organizes. In summer they run courses in 20 different sports ranging from surfing, canoeing or sailing, to tennis, hang-gliding or climbing. The school organizes sports activities such as football and volleyball matches, horseback rides, bike rides, and excursions to the mountains.
Lacunza also makes the most of the wonderful culture and scenery in the Basque country with excursions to all places of interest such as the Guggenheim Museum in Bilbao or Hemingway's Pamplona and the Running of the Bulls.
